Untangling the Mysteries of Supplication Prayer

Supplication prayer, a form deeply entrenched in many spiritual traditions, offers devotees a path to connect with the divine. It involves making heartfelt pleas for guidance, assistance, and welfare. While the essence of supplication prayer is shared, its expression can vary widely across cultures and faiths.

Some traditions stress the importance of specific phrases, while others prioritize on the sincerity and depth of the desire. Deciphering these diverse interpretations can be a process that enriches our own spiritual understanding.
